Latest revision as of 09:51, 30 May 2026
- This task should be performed every week, after journalling on Sunday evening
- The journal listing page, Journal, should have all links and text entries more than 1 week old moved to the page Older journal entries
- On the page Older journal entries, those entries should be appended to the top of that page entered under "Sub-heading 2" composed of the date 1 week ago in the format YEAR-MONTH-DAY. In the heading next to that, add a link back to Journal. For example the level2 heading might look like this: "2026-5-17 - back to Journal".
